SOUTHEAST FISHERIES OBSERVER PROGRAM (SEFOP) OBSERVER SERVICES EXTENSION

NOTICE OF INTENT TO NEGOTIATE FOR AN ACTION EXCEEDING THE SIMPLIFIED ACQUISITION THRESHOLD USING SIMPLIFIED PROCEDURES FOR CERTAIN COMMERCIAL ITEMS SOUTHEAST FISHERIES SCIENCE CENTER (SEFSC) SOUTHEAST FISHERIES OBSERVER PROGRAM (SEFOP) OBSERVER SERVICES National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) Fisheries hereby gives public notice of the intent to negotiate a sole-source action for Task Order 1305M325F0020 under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) Contract 1305M219DNFFN0019, to extend observer services from December 21, 2025 through March 31, 2026, pursuant to the authority of Federal Acquisition Requirements (FAR) 13.501(a) and 41 U.S.C. 1901. FAR 6.302-1(a)(2) and 41 USC 3304(a)(1) establishes authority for the government to seek services from A.I.S., Incorporated (AIS) to manage the recruitment, selection, supervision, and outfitting of all sea-going personnel needed to fulfill federal fisheries obligations of the SEFSC for the geographic area encompassed by the coastal states from North Carolina through Texas, as well as Puerto Rico and the U.S. Virgin Islands in the U.S. Caribbean. These federal fisheries obligations are part of the National Observer Program and are authorized by statute under the Magnuson-Stevens Fishery Conservation and Management Act. The SEFOP operates in Federal reef-fish, shrimp, and pelagic longline fisheries in the Gulf of America, Caribbean and Western North Atlantic Ocean. More than 500 observers are deployed across 11 U.S. observer programs, the majority of which are managed by NOAA Fisheries’ six regional Fisheries Science Centers. Observers act as the sole, independent data source for specific types of information, including bycatch composition and mortality, economic and regulatory discards, as well as gear interactions with marine mammals, seabirds, sea turtles, and many other protected resources. The observer collected data is utilized in various regional stock assessments. SEFSC Observer Services requires the Contractor to provide and retain the necessary qualified personnel, material, services, and facilities (except as otherwise specified) to perform quality environmental, biological, and fisheries operations data collection for SEFSC Observer programs.
